Clé Primaire Compose Mysql Java — Maison Avec Etang A Vendre En Gironde Rose
Meilleur moyen d'écrire des requêtes SQL de base J'ai une table avec une clé primaire composée de deux colonnes entières. Je stocke environ 200 millions de lignes dans ce tableau. Mon programme doit obtenir la table complète triée par les colonnes de la clé primaire dans le même ordre. Donc, ma requête ressemble à Select * from MYTABLE order by PK1, PK2; J'ai remarqué qu'au lieu d'envoyer des données immédiatement, la requête passe beaucoup de temps dans l'état "résultat du tri". J'aurais pensé que mysql utiliserait l'index de clé primaire pour accéder aux données directement dans l'ordre requis. Mais, il semble qu'il le scanne sans ordre, puis trie les données par la suite. Est-il possible de modifier le comportement et de rendre la requête plus efficace? Remarque: j'ai essayé d'utiliser mysql 5. 5 et mariadb10. 2.
- Clé primaire composée mysql.com
- Clé primaire compose mysql plugin
- Clé primaire compose mysql data
- Maison avec etang a vendre en gironde un nouveau centre
- Maison avec etang a vendre en gironde streaming
Clé Primaire Composée Mysql.Com
24/05/2015, 17h05 #1 Sélection sur une clé primaire composée Bonjour, Je débute sous PhpAdmin. J'ai créé une table dont la clé primaire est composée des «Nom» et «Prénom». Les index de l'onglet «Structure» font bien apparaitre ces deux champs sous un index nommé «PRIMARY». L'instruction SELECT * FROM `musicien` WHERE PRIMARY = "ArmstrongLouis' me renvoie le message «Erreur de syntaxe près de 'PRIMARY = "ArmstrongLouis'' à la ligne 1». Comment dois-je écrire cette requête? Je vous remercie d'avance pour vos réponses. 24/05/2015, 17h39 #2 Membre habitué Je pense que ça sera mieux comme ça 1 2 SELECT * FROM `musicien` WHERE nom = 'Armstrong' and prenom = 'louis' 24/05/2015, 17h55 #3 Bien sûr, ça, je savais que ça marchait. Mais j'ai créé cette clé composite pour pouvoir l'utiliser, entre autres, via la concaténation du nom et du prénom dans d'autres requêtes et ne pas devoir tester sur le nom et le prénom. 24/05/2015, 19h44 #4 La clé composée PRIMARY est elle une une rubrique de ta table, ou simplement un index?
Clé Primaire Compose Mysql Plugin
Il sera probablement plus efficace pour votre programme de trier les données après l'avoir obtenu. Je me suis demandé s'il ne devrait pas y avoir de tri du tout car un index induit un tri. Par exemple, une carte en C ++ vous permet d'itérer sur vos éléments dans l'ordre des clés La clé primaire composée est-elle dans le même ordre, PK1 suivi de PK2? Que fait EXPLAIN {query} Afficher? Il se peut que votre version de MySQL ait un bogue et cela est corrigé dans les versions ultérieures. Faire en sorte que la base de données fasse correctement les choses, comme le tri et l'utilisation des index, est nettement mieux que d'écrire les vôtres. Les tables MySQL sont classées par clé primaire dans une arborescence B +. À part, pourquoi récupérez-vous 200 millions de lignes? Cela ressemble à une chose étrange à faire (sauf pour une sauvegarde). Il y a peut-être une meilleure façon. Salut. Ceci est une FAQ, google. Les tableaux n'ont pas d'ordre. Les instructions sélectionnées avec ordre par ont des résultats ordonnés.
Clé Primaire Compose Mysql Data
Les implémentations ont un ordre mais cela ne détermine pas l'ordre des résultats de la requête. Une mise en œuvre efficace nécessite des index. Les index peuvent être commandés. Lisez toutes les mentions de contraintes et d'index dans le manuel. Aussi - veuillez montrer toutes vos sorties DDL & EXPLAIN. ENGINE=MyISAM, c'est la raison du plan de requête choisi. Si la table utilisait le InnoDB moteur, alors l'index de clé primaire serait la clé groupée de la table, donc il n'aurait pas à faire de tri après l'avoir lu, car la requête ORDER BY correspond à la clé primaire. Avec MyISAM, il a deux options: lire l'index et la table (du tas) (sans trier) ou seulement la table et faire un tri. Il choisit le second car l'optimiseur pense qu'il est plus rapide. 2 Merci! Y a-t-il un indice qui obligerait l'optimiseur à choisir l'autre alternative? J'ai remarqué que parfois, il ne choisissait pas la meilleure stratégie. 1 Je vous suggère d'utiliser le moteur InnoDB. MyISAM n'est là que parce qu'il était le moteur par défaut il y a dix ans.
X x Recevez les nouvelles annonces par email! Recevez de nouvelles annonces par email étang aquitaine Trier par Villes Biscarrosse 2 Thors 2 Agen 1 Aubin 1 Avensan 1 Coutras 1 Gujan-Mestras 1 Le Buis 1 Montrol-Sénard 1 Mornac-sur-Seudre 1 Départements Charente-Maritime 3 Gironde 3 Haute-Vienne 3 Landes 2 Charente 1 Dordogne 1 Essonne 1 Lot-et-Garonne 1 Options parking 0 obra_nueva 0 Avec photos 8 Prix en baisse! 0 Date de publication Moins de 24h 0 Moins de 7 jours 0 X Soyez le premier à connaitre les nouvelles offres pour étang aquitaine x Recevez les nouvelles annonces par email!
Maison Avec Etang A Vendre En Gironde Un Nouveau Centre
etang a vendre gironde pas cher May 23, 2017 etang ha gironde: maisons à vendre sur le plus gros site d'annonces entre particuliers et agences immobilières en france. nous avons 6 terrains à vendre à partir de 36 500€ pour votre re cher che etang gironde. trouvez ce que vous cher chez au meilleur prix: terrains à vendre – département gironde. a vendre par particulier terrain agricole avec petit étang et bâtiment en pierre dans le sud ouest, aquitaine, proche gironde charente en… 36 500€. 40700 m². ajouter aux favoris … proche du bourg de mialet, étang de 9000 m² pas aux normes sur 2ha de terrain parfaitement au calme. honoraires inclus charge acquéreur: … leggett: lacs et étangs à vendre – 31 propriété(s) trouvée(s) | page 1 | trié par date de dernière modification du plus récent au plus ancien. corps de ferme et étang de 10 ha à vendre. – haute-vienne (87). 187027 -. 699 000 € hai. voir la fiche · etang de 4, 5 ha avec cheptel important. – cher (18). Maison terrain etang gironde - maisons à Gironde - Mitula Immobilier. 118012 -. 267 000 € hai. voir la fiche · pêche à la truite et restauration – fonds de commerce.
Maison Avec Etang A Vendre En Gironde Streaming
Elle se compose au rez-de-chaussée d'un séjour avec cheminée, une cuisine, une véranda; à l'... À 20 minutes de bordeaux-centre, sur la commune de carignan de bordeaux. Dans un environnement calme, arboré et sans vis à vis: ravissante maison au cachet exceptionnel, de 270 m² habitables, située dans un parc de 5000... Maison avec etang a vendre en gironde streaming. Immobilier transaxia sud-ouest. À 5 mn de langon dans un quartier très calme, à découvrir sans tarder cette agréable maison de plain pied composée d'une entrée, d'un séjour très lumineux avec cheminée et climatisation r... Transaxia Sud-ouestA saisir! Beau potentiel pour cet ancien corps de ferme d'environ 144 m², à rénover, orienté plein sud, dans un petit village, à 5 minutes des premiers commerces, secteur La Réole. Cette maison en pi... Croignon, maison familiale 9 pièces entièrement rénovée avec goût, d'une surface habitable de 263 m² située à 22 km de bordeaux, à 1, 8 km de camarsac offrant le charme de la campagne à proximité de la métropole bordelais... PRIX EN BAISSE.
Pièces 1+ pièces 2+ pièces 3+ pièces 4+ pièces Superficie: m² Personnalisez 0 - 15 m² 15 - 30 m² 30 - 45 m² 45 - 60 m² 60 - 75 m² 75 - 120 m² 120 - 165 m² 165 - 210 m² 210 - 255 m² 255 - 300 m² 300+ m² ✚ Voir plus... Salles de bains 1+ salles de bains 2+ salles de bains 3+ salles de bains 4+ salles de bains Visualiser les 30 propriétés sur la carte >